About The Position

Merrill Wealth Management is a leading provider of comprehensive wealth management and investment products and services for individuals, companies, and institutions. Merrill Wealth Management is one of the largest businesses of its kind in the world specializing in goals-based wealth management, including planning for retirement, education, legacy, and other life goals through investment advice and guidance. Merrill’s Financial Advisors and Wealth Management Client Associates help clients pursue the life they envision through a personal relationship with their advisory team committed to their needs. Requirements

  • Displays confidence working in a sales role
  • Builds strong client relationships through effective communication and collaboration
  • Displays a proactive mindset and effective time management
  • Demonstrates a results-driven mindset and prioritizes client interests
  • Identifies appropriate client solutions through application of learnings and new information
  • Applies relevant regulatory due diligence in daily activities and creating long-term client strategies
  • Subject to SAFE Act registration requirements, including registration and background check.

Nice To Haves

  • Bachelor’s degree
  • Minimum of one year of financial services industry or sales experience
  • Learns and adapts to new technology or applications
  • Executes multiple tasks simultaneously

Responsibilities

  • Obtain Securities Industry licenses, including SIE, Series 7 and Series 66 Exams.
  • Learn and apply foundational skills for an advisor role, including acquiring, building, and managing client relationships.
  • Consider a client’s complex financial picture and guide them with advice and solutions.
  • Humanize financial interactions.
  • Deliver Bank of America’s core banking and investment solutions and approach to client care.
  • Build a new portfolio of affluent and high net worth clients.
  • Progress through the stages of the Advisor Development Program (ADP) with the ultimate aim of becoming a core Merrill Financial Advisor.
